Christopher S Swezey, Ph.D.

Christopher Swezey is the Program Coordinator of the USGS National Cooperative Geologic Mapping Program. He leads strategic planning and coordination to meet Program requirements, including implementation and funding of FEDMAP, STATEMAP, EDMAP, and the National Geologic Map Database. This work is done in collaboration with State Geological Surveys, federal scientists, and academic partners.
